Scholar Life

Oak Springs is an East Austin school serving a majority of scholars from the Booker T. Washington Housing Complex. Our school's community is working together with the faculty, staff, and administrative team to ensure scholar success.

Through these efforts last year, our scholars increased their gains on the Texas Assessment of Knowledge and Skills (TAKS) test. The faculty and staff would like to acknowledge the strong support of our parents and partners in helping our scholars make these important gains.

School Goals

At Oak Springs, we are working to increase scholar achievement in reading, math, and writing. To that end, we use teaching strategies and research that access multiple intelligences and all modalities of scholar learning.

We are also working to improve citizenship and social skills and to implement effective school-wide discipline and citizenship plans. In the coming year, we hope to increase parental involvement and communicate consistently and positively with parents and scholars.

To support our scholars, we regularly involve parents in school activities that increase student achievement. We plan to implement and evaluate an incentive plan to reward parents and scholars for parental involvement in school activities.

Other goals include the development, implementation, and evaluation of the after school program and increasing student attendance.

Major Programs and Initiatives

At Oak Springs, we offer a variety of programs and initiatives to support our scholars, including:

  • Christian Outreach Foundation After School Program
  • Heart House After School Program
  • UT Neighborhood Longhorn Tutoring
  • After School Tutorials
  • Americorp
  • Music Memory
  • Book Boosters
  • RIF Program (Reading Is Fundamental)
  • Saturday Learning Camps
  • Summer School
  • CATCH
  • PALS
  • Safety Patrol
  • CIS-Smart Kids Program
  • Marathon Kids
  • Girls on the Run
  • Safe Routes To School Program
  • College Prep
